Ingredients
- 14 oz firm tofu
- 3 tbsp soy sauce
- 2 tbsp rice vinegar
- 1 tbsp maple syrup
- 1/2 cup toasted cashews
- 1 (1 cup sliced) bell peppers
- 1 (1/2 cup julienned) carrots
- 2 cloves (minced) garlic
- 1 tbsp (minced) ginger
- 1 tsp sesame oil
- 1 tbsp cornstarch
Instructions
- Step 1: Press 14 oz firm tofu for 30 minutes to remove excess water, then cut into 1-inch cubes. Toss cubes with 1 tbsp cornstarch and let sit for 5 minutes while preparing sauce.
- Step 2: Whisk 3 tbsp soy sauce, 2 tbsp rice vinegar, 1 tbsp maple syrup, and 1 tsp sesame oil in a small bowl. Heat 1 tbsp oil in a wok over high heat, add tofu cubes, and cook for 4-5 minutes until golden brown on all sides. Remove tofu and set aside.
- Step 3: Add remaining 1 tbsp oil to the wok, stir-fry 2 minced garlic cloves and 1 tbsp minced ginger for 30 seconds until fragrant. Add 1 cup sliced bell peppers and 1/2 cup julienned carrots, stir-frying for 3-4 minutes until crisp-tender. Return tofu to wok, pour in sauce, and add 1/2 cup toasted cashews. Cook for 2 more minutes until sauce thickens and coats everything.

How do I store leftover The Best Tofu Stir-Fry with Cashews?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ep firm tofu from drying out.

How do I scale The Best Tofu Stir-Fry with Cashews for a different number of people?
The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
